F1 ACADEMY: Pulling edges out Weug and Pin to secure double pole in Singapore

Abbi Pulling was unstoppable on the streets of Singapore, as the Alpine driver went from strength-to-strength to beat Ferrari’s Maya Weug and Mercedes’ Doriane Pin for both pole positions.
The trio traded times throughout the session, but it was Pulling’s 2:03.631 that put her top of the timing sheets with five minutes to go.
Weug pipped her PREMA Racing teammate for second on the grid for Race 1 by 0.027s, but Pin repaid the favour, securing the front row spot alongside Pulling for Race 2.
Lia Block saved her best for last and earned two personal best Qualifying results, as the Williams driver lines up fourth for both races.
For Race 1, Hamda Al Qubaisi will start from fifth followed by the Campos Racing pair of Chloe Chambers and Nerea Martí. Wild Card Ella Lloyd put on an impressive performance to seal eighth ahead of Bianca Bustamante and Carrie Schreiner.

Pulling will once again line up on pole for Race 2 ahead of Pin, Weug, Block and Martí. Hamda Al Qubaisi’s second-fastest lap was good enough for sixth followed by Schreiner, Lloyd, Chambers and Bustamante.
